Umwandlung String->Objekt
-
ich habe eine ArrayList die kann ich mit toString() in einen String umwandeln um sie so z.b. zu übertragen.
Meine Frage wie kann ich diese String wieder in eine ArrayList umwandeln.
dort gibts nur .add(Object)
-
Überlege dir ersteinmal ob es überhaupt günstig ist die schöne ArrayList in einen platten String zu hämmern.
Ich benutze die toString() Methode nur in Logging Anweisungen oder um eine aussagekräftige Exception zu erzeugen.
Was für Daten stecken in deiner ArrayList,wohin willst du sie Transportieren und welches Medium benutzt du dafür?
-
über Netzwerk (TCP/IP Socket) will ichs senden,
es sind boolsche Daten
-
Ich glaube das ist der falsche Weg den du da einschlägst.
Schau dir mal Serialisierung unter Java an.
Damit kannst du Objekte ohne sie vorher umzuwandeln versenden.
-
Jo, und so Standard-Klassen wie String, Integer, Float, etc. implementieren glaub' ich alle Serializable. Denke, da wird's auch einen Typ Bool oder so geben...